Chapter 14 titled "Consciousness Research and Quantum Effects," functions as an extensive overview of scientific attempts to link human consciousness with quantum mechanics, particularly focusing on phenomena that challenge classical physics, such as remote perception and mind-matter interaction. The source details the methodological challenges faced by researchers like Dr. Rachel Torres in studying these potentially quantum effects, as their inherent probabilistic nature and sensitivity to observer effects defy traditional, deterministic experimental protocols. Baggett specifically reviews several major research efforts, including the work of the Princeton Engineering Anomalies Research (PEAR) laboratory, Lynn McTaggart's Intention Experiments, and the Global Consciousness Project (GCP), all of which documented small but statistically significant correlations between focused consciousness and random physical systems. Furthermore, the text addresses the replication crisis in the field, arguing that failures may stem from quantum sensitivity rather than non-existence of the phenomena, and suggests that meditation and subjective states may be crucial for optimizing these subtle quantum consciousness effects.
